Conflans-Sainte-Honorine Mosquito Forecast

If you're planning outdoor activities near the scenic confluence of the Seine and Oise rivers in Conflans-Sainte-Honorine, keeping an eye on the local mosquito forecast is essential. Our Conflans-Sainte-Honorine mosquito forecast shows heightened mosquito activity from May through September, peaking in July and August with a forecast rating of 8 out of 10. Mosquitoes thrive in the warm, humid conditions typical of summer here, especially around the riverbanks and the famous marina. Mosquito-Borne Diseases in the Conflans-Sainte-Honorine Area

While Conflans-Sainte-Honorine is not a hotspot for severe mosquito-borne diseases, vigilance is still important. The primary concern is the potential transmission of West Nile Virus and, occasionally, imported cases of dengue or chikungunya during warmer months. Preventive measures include: 1. Using insect repellent when outdoors 2. Wearing long sleeves and pants during peak mosquito hours 3. Eliminating standing water around homes For up-to-date health advisories, the Santé Publique France website is a reliable resource to monitor any emerging risks in the Île-de-France region.

When is the peak mosquito season in Conflans-Sainte-Honorine?

The peak mosquito season typically occurs between July and August, with activity starting to rise from May and tapering off after September.
